Can I Clean Toilet With Soda Crystals. Scrub and flush for a sparkly, clean toilet. To clean a toilet with soda crystals, simply sprinkle some crystals into the toilet bowl, then scrub the bowl with a stiff toilet brush. To tackle limescale buildup, pour plenty.
